Transaction f3bfd26f37775a4c98b16e634a34e6b10f8675c63542682020083778925333da

12 Input
2 Outputs
  • f3bfd26f37775a4c98b16e634a34e6b10f8675c63542682020083778925333da:0
  • value  252354000
    address  1CCB8bobQRTyawMGjEgrzcDSz5PS47tew5
  • f3bfd26f37775a4c98b16e634a34e6b10f8675c63542682020083778925333da:1
  • value  1039678
    address  3CZqnzCYeh83sxv9P2bpoVHFn7n5cccfbz